Eriogonum sphaerocephalum

Botanical Description

Douglas ex Benth. Perennial with a woody, much-branched caudex and decumbent stems 5-12cm in length. Leaves oblanceolate, l-3cm long, almost glabrous above, tomentose beneath, in whorls at the upper nodes. Flowering stems 5-15cm long, ascending to erect. Flowers solitary or in umbels, cream to yellow, solitary or in umbels, cream to yellow, summer. California to Washington State and Nevada, in dry rocky localities in sagebrush, pine-juniper woodland at 900-2250m.
